Prescott Leads Cowboys By Struggling Washington Commanders to Launch Christmas Tripleheader.

The Cowboys' quarterback accumulated 307 yards and two touchdowns, as Dallas squandered a large portion of an 18-point lead before squeezing past the Washington Commanders 30-23 on Thursday night.

Dallas (7-8-1) scored touchdowns on their first three possessions to build a 21-3 lead. Although the Commanders (4-12) closed the deficit to a touchdown on three separate instances, they were unable to finish the comeback and absorbed their 10th loss in 11 games.

Each squad were already out from postseason consideration, which severely lessened the stakes of this contest between historic NFC East rivals.

Prescott's Historic Outing

Prescott connected on 19 of 37 passes and helped Dallas convert all six of its fourth-down tries. His two TD passes gave him 30 for the season, equaling the franchise record of four seasons with at least 30 touchdown passes.

Prescott shrugged off six sacks, with three coming from Jer’Zhan Newton.

Washington's QB Situation

Playing without injured quarterbacks Jayden Daniels (elbow) and Marcus Mariota (quad, hand), Washington turned to 39-year-old journeyman Josh Johnson. Making his 10th career start and first since 2021, Johnson was 15 for 23 for 198 yards with no touchdowns or interceptions.

Washington's Offensive Highlights

Jacory Croskey-Merritt found paydirt with runs of 10 and 72 yards for Washington. The 72-yard scamper got the Commanders to 24-17 in the third quarter, but Dallas restored its double-digit lead with a 52-yard kick by kicker Brandon Aubrey.

The kicker later nailed a 51-yarder to extend the lead to 30-20 with 3:59 remaining.

Following a Prescott touchdown pass to tight end Jake Ferguson on the game’s opening drive, Johnson completed three passes for 68 yards to get Washington to 7-3. A crucial connection was a 41-yard pass to Deebo Samuel, Johnson’s biggest play since 2018.

Dallas' Sustained Drives

On their next drive, the Cowboys converted three fourth downs on a lengthy, 17-play drive that ended with a touchdown run by Javonte Williams. Prescott then made it three TDs in three drives with an 86-yard touchdown strike to KaVontae Turpin.
